In a new twist of events, the Benue State Governor Samuel Ortom who was the candidate of the People’s Democratic Party for the Benue northwest senatorial district in the just concluded National Assembly elections has withdrawn his petition against the winner.
Ortom who made this known to newsmen at the Government House in Makurdi says it is in the interest of peace and without prejudice to suits filled by other candidates of the PDP.
Governor Samuel Ortom, candidate of the People’s democratic party for Benue north west district breaks the news of his withdrawal.

And this was after he met with critical stakeholders of the zone including members of his campaign council at the Government house Makurdi.
Ortom lost his Senatorial bid to Titus Zam of the All Progressives Congress (APC,) an election he expressed dissatisfaction with, but now decided to overlook.
